在当今这个技术飞速发展的时代,企业构建应用的方式正在经历一场全面变革。对于想要快速开发、快速上线且无需太多技术背景支持的团队来说,低代码工具无疑是一项“神兵利器”。它不仅帮助技术人员解放双手,也让更多非技术背景人士能参与到应用开发的流程中。不过,市面上的低代码工具琳琅满目,该如何选择适合自己需求的工具?别急,这里就为你详尽分析低代码工具的类别、热门案例以及它们背后的强大逻辑。
低代码工具(Low-Code Development Tools)是指那些允许用户通过少量编码或者图形界面拖拽的方式来构建软件应用的平台。这类工具本质上是用一种简单直观的方式,把开发中常见的重复性任务流程化、模块化,让技术瓶颈被降到最低。
低代码之所以突然间变得火热,其源头可以追溯到软件开发过程中长期存在的“资源不足”问题:具有深厚技术背景的开发人员数量少,而同时企业数字化转型需求却越来越多。低代码工具很好地填补了这个空白,为技术人员提供了一个更高效的“工具箱”,也让非技术用户有机会探足开发领域。
简单来说,低代码工具实现了以下两大优势:
这两点对于时间紧张、预算有限的企业尤为关键,尤其是在如今强调灵活敏捷的市场环境下。
低代码工具并非“万能”,但它一定是解决某些特定需求的最佳选择。以下几类场景是低代码平台的“主场”:
很多企业需要根据自身业务逻辑构建特定的内部系统,比如员工管理、绩效评估、项目进度跟踪等。传统开发方式成本高、时间长,而低代码工具可以快速搭建满足基本需求的系统,减少资源消耗。
在金融、医疗、电商等数据驱动型行业,数据的呈现至关重要。低代码工具可以帮助快速开发数据分析类应用,甚至实现动态图表或者预测模型的展示功能,让决策更高效。
很多中小型企业需要客户管理系统,但是由于预算不足可能无法购买高端定制化服务。低代码工具可以快速搭建属于企业自身的CRM系统,并根据需求进行实时调整。
移动端和桌面端应用开发通过低代码工具可以同步进行。许多工具提供“写一次、运行多处”的模式,既能满足安卓、iOS端,也能在网页端顺利运行。
接下来我们盘点几个热门的低代码工具。每种工具都有其专属的亮点和目标用户群体,无论你是大型企业还是个人创业团队,都能找到适合你的解决方案。
Mendix 是目前市场上极为成熟的低代码开发平台之一,它以开发简单、部署快速而闻名。对开发者和非技术用户都很友好,支持完整的应用生命周期管理。
适用场景:企业级应用开发,包括客户管理、工作流自动化等。
OutSystems 被认为是企业构建复杂应用的绝佳选择,该工具注重高度可扩展性,同时提供了广泛的第三方集成插件。
适用场景:需要大规模系统集成和ERP匹配的企业。
微软出品的 Power Apps 是一款强大且简洁易用的低代码工具。在与 Office365 和 SharePoint 整合上有天然的优势,非常适合熟悉微软生态的用户。
适用场景:需要结合微软办公生态构建工具的团队。
以企业自动化为目标的 Appian 擅长流程管理、审批系统开发。它的用户界面简洁清爽,适配多个业务场景。
适用场景:需要复杂业务逻辑支持的企业。
Bubble.io 更注重于为创业者和小型团队服务,其最大的亮点是完全通过拖拽操作实现完整应用开发。
适用场景:想快速试验产品 MVP 的小团队。
选择低代码工具时,企业需要结合自身需求和资源情况进行综合分析。以下几个因素值得根据具体情况权衡:
低代码工具的未来不仅仅是一个“快速开发”的趋势,它还会进一步推动更多人走进技术领域。可以预见,未来随着人工智能的进一步成熟,低代码工具会实现更深度的智能化,比如从需求说明直接生成应用的能力。
此外,低代码平台的专属生态系统可能更完整。从第三方 API 集成到云端部署,再到运维监控,未来的低代码平台将以“一站式解决方案”为目标,成为企业数字化道路上的核心工具。
可以说,低代码并不是在取代开发,而是在重新定义开发的门槛。它为企业带来了不一样的视角,同时也降低了创新的成本。无论你是工程师,还是初创公司的负责人,一套合适的低代码工具一定是你实现梦想的加速器。
那么,你准备好迎接低代码带来的变革了吗?行动起来,在探索中找到属于你的最优解吧!
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。